Two Brown Shoes will soon start the complex, yet fun redevelopment of www.sydneystormchasers.com

Sydney Storm Chasers first appeared in 1997 at Thunderstuck storm chasing designed by Ben Quinn (responsible for Brisbane Storm Chasers Homepage : a time when websites were labeled with 'homepage'). In '99 the page was redesigned into Sydney Storm Chasers, with James Harris and myself coming on board. In early 2002, the current site of the Sydney Storm Chasers was lauched and in its somewhat fragile setup has been cataloging storm chasing accross NSW since.
The problem is that with when a site is 7 years old - it reaches a critical mass. Information systems are totally out of date and some of the early structures created that reflected the prevailing web usages become sorely outdated.
The site averages about 200 unique hits per day in the off season and nearly 400-600 in the storm season. Scarily there are more holes in the site than in a poorly scripted Vin Diesel movie. Our aim is to turn it into a blog news site, with a vast gallery, online storm report and news .rss feed, video gallery and some more funky additions - something that is fairly original for the weather community.
